index.d.ts 1.0 KB

123456789101112
  1. import SummaryRow from './Row';
  2. import SummaryCell from './Cell';
  3. import type { DefaultRecordType, StickyOffsets } from '../interface';
  4. import type { FlattenColumns } from '../context/SummaryContext';
  5. export interface FooterProps<RecordType = DefaultRecordType> {
  6. stickyOffsets: StickyOffsets;
  7. flattenColumns: FlattenColumns<RecordType>;
  8. }
  9. declare const _default: import("vue").DefineComponent<FooterProps<any>, {}, {}, {}, {}, import("vue").ComponentOptionsMixin, import("vue").ComponentOptionsMixin, {}, string, import("vue").VNodeProps & import("vue").AllowedComponentProps & import("vue").ComponentCustomProps, Readonly<FooterProps<any>>, {}>;
  10. export default _default;
  11. export { SummaryRow, SummaryCell };
  12. export declare const FooterComponents: import("vue").DefineComponent<import("./Summary").SummaryProps, {}, {}, {}, {}, import("vue").ComponentOptionsMixin, import("vue").ComponentOptionsMixin, {}, string, import("vue").VNodeProps & import("vue").AllowedComponentProps & import("vue").ComponentCustomProps, Readonly<import("./Summary").SummaryProps>, {}>;